Text, Folio 7 (verso), from a Kalpa-sutra

Cleveland Museum of Art

The image shows a yellowed, aged manuscript page with text written in black ink and red accents. The page is rectangular, with the top and bottom edges slightly curved. The text is written in a non-Latin script, possibly Devanagari, and is arranged in lines that run horizontally across the page. There are three red circles on the page, one on the left side, one in the middle, and one on the right side. Two red vertical lines run along the left and right sides of the page, with the left line positioned to the right of the left red circle and the right line to the left of the right red circle. The background of the image is a plain gray color, visible around the edges of the manuscript page. The text on the page appears to be from a Kalpa-sutra, with the specific page being Folio 7 (verso). The artist of the manuscript is not visually identifiable from the image.
